UK launch: Tathaastu

Milton Keynes based Guideline Publications has announced the UK launch of lifestyle magazine Tathaastu.

Currently available internationally in over 20 countries, the magazine launches in the UK on 24 April and is dedicated to the well-being of mind, body and soul and features in-depth articles on yoga and holistic practices.

Guideline Publications is the publishing arm of Regal Litho, a printing and publishing company, based in Milton Keynes.

Alan Corkhill, Managing Director of Guideline says: “We are proud to be instrumental in the UK launch of Tathaastu magazine, exclusively managing subscriptions and print for the publication, and utilising the expertise of Tom Foxon to manage the commercial and news stand sales. Tathaastu is a unique magazine which focuses on eastern wisdom for health and spirituality and has already been a great success globally. I have no doubt that success will continue in the UK.”

The magazine will be published six times a year and is written by a diverse group of writers and photographers worldwide, and includes contributions from experts in the field of spirituality, yoga, nutrition, ayurveda and alternative therapies.

Tathaastu will be available on the high street, and is being stocked by WHSmiths.

Guideline is also planning to launch Tathaastu magazine in the Netherlands.
